Unleashing Adventure: 2017 Africa Twin Motorcycle Specifications Explained

The 2017 Africa Twin, officially known as the Honda CRF1000L, is a motorcycle that has garnered significant attention in the adventure touring segment. With its combination of rugged off-road capabilities and comfortable on-road performance, it symbolizes Honda's commitment to creating versatile and reliable bikes. Engine and Performance

Engine Specifications

The heart of the Africa Twin is its powerful engine:

  • Type: Liquid-cooled, 4-stroke, parallel-twin
  • Displacement: 998 cc
  • Bore x Stroke: 92 mm x 75.1 mm
  • Compression Ratio: 10.0:1
  • Maximum Power: 94 hp (70 kW) @ 7,500 rpm
  • Maximum Torque: 73 lb-ft (99 Nm) @ 6,000 rpm

Transmission

The Africa Twin offers versatility in its transmission options:

  • Transmission Type: 6-speed manual or 6-speed DCT (Dual Clutch Transmission)
  • Final Drive: Chain

Chassis and Suspension

Frame and Dimensions

The physical dimensions and structure of the Africa Twin include:

  • Frame Type: Steel twin tube
  • Wheelbase: 58.7 inches (1,490 mm)
  • Seat Height: 33.5 inches (850 mm)
  • Dry Weight: 503 lbs (228 kg)

Suspension System

The suspension system is designed for both comfort and ruggedness:

  • Front Suspension: 45 mm Showa inverted fork with 9.1 inches (230 mm) of travel
  • Rear Suspension: Pro-Link monoshock with 8.7 inches (220 mm) of travel

Brakes and Tires

Braking System

The braking system ensures safety across diverse riding conditions:

  • Front Brake: Dual 310 mm discs with 3-piston calipers
  • Rear Brake: Single 256 mm disc with a 2-piston caliper
  • ABS: Standard, with an option to deactivate for off-road use

Tires

The choice of tires enhances performance and handling:

  • Front Tire: 90/90-21
  • Rear Tire: 150/70-18
